Autor Tema: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D  (Leído 42204 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Desconectado Suky

  • Moderador Local
  • DsPIC33
  • *****
  • Mensajes: 6743
    • Micros-Designs
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#45 en: 05 de Diciembre de 2011, 15:30:38 »
El PCB de la placa SkP32 directamente fue mandada a fabricar, o sea se enviaron los Gerber. Planchar esa placa es imposible. Ahora si se diseña la PCB pensando en el planchado o insolado, en mi caso he usado la impresora Laser Samsung ml-1640 con toner original y a 1200 ppp. Luego el papel es muy parecido al fotográfico o también el del contact.


Saludos!
No contesto mensajes privados, las consultas en el foro

Desconectado xp8100

  • PIC12
  • **
  • Mensajes: 71
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#46 en: 06 de Diciembre de 2011, 17:29:16 »
Asunto resuelto, he pedido un par de estos adaptadores.
TQFP100 PCB Converter

Desconectado MerLiNz

  • Colaborador
  • PIC24H
  • *****
  • Mensajes: 2463
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#47 en: 07 de Diciembre de 2011, 08:26:19 »
te tenias que haber pillado este TQFP100 trae para poner el ICSP, y por detras trae para poner todos los condensadores, resistencias de mclr...

Desconectado xp8100

  • PIC12
  • **
  • Mensajes: 71
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#48 en: 07 de Diciembre de 2011, 09:19:35 »
MerlinZ, de esos he pedido 2  :o
Fue mi primera opción, pero luego me lie con los 04mm y los 0,5 mm.
Finalmente he pedido los de 100, estos que tu comentas y unos de 64 contactos.

¿Los has usado alguna vez los que tu comentas?

Un abrazo,

Jc

Desconectado MerLiNz

  • Colaborador
  • PIC24H
  • *****
  • Mensajes: 2463
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#49 en: 07 de Diciembre de 2011, 10:07:10 »
nop, yo al igua lque tu tambien me pille de 64 y otro que habia de 100 0.4 por una cara y 100 0.5 por otra. El de 64 no me valio, era demasiado grande para un pic32 que tenia por aqui. Y de 100 estoy esperando que me llegen los samples de microchip de 100 pins. El de 64 no ponia nada de medidas ni nada, vamos fue una compra a ciegas pero no sirve.

No te lies con 0.4 y 0.5, depende del formato que tengas mirando el datasheet sabes la separacion que tienes, normalmente los de 0.5 son pics mas grandes 12x12, y los de 0.4 de 10x10 (hablando de tqfp100), si miras el final del datasheet veras a que me refiero, segun elijas una opcion u otra tambien te pone la separacion entre patillas.


Desconectado xp8100

  • PIC12
  • **
  • Mensajes: 71
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#50 en: 09 de Diciembre de 2011, 21:00:52 »
Saludos Suky.
Pues aqui ando liado redibujando tus esquemas del proyecto SKP32. La idea es meter en una PCB de 15x10 simple cara, tu diseño para hacerlo asequible a más gente (ya veremos como queda).
Estoy usando EAGLE y en el momento que los termine y afine, los subo para ver si sirven para que algún "pirado" más se anime y "ruede la bola".
He respetado tu diseño, añadiendo un conector ICD10 para conectar una módulo Ethernet ENC28j60, un reset mediante un DS1233 y un zocalo para montar una placa huesped con la MCU 32, 24 o dsp33.
El caso es que revisando tu esquema me he encontrado con alguna preguntas, que si tienes a bien me gustaría remitirte:
1.- Que cristal montaste finalmente en la placa y el valor de los condensadores C4, C5, C6 y C7 (indicas entre 17 y 22pf). Si me indicas exactamente tu valor, te lo agradecería.
2.- Cual es el motivo de R3 en el conector USB X2 a RF7 (SDI1).? Indicas no colocar si MCU no USB, pero aun así no lo entiendo.
3.- Podrías proporcionarme el Fottprint en formato EAGLE para TPS2041B?. No hay forma de encontrarlo en ninguna libreía de CADSOFT.
4.- Por que R7 conectada a RG9?
5.- C2 es recomendable de tántalo en lugar de Electrolítico?.
6.- Por que SWITCH VUSB para conectar RF6 a +3V3?.
7.- En el conector SV4, existen dos conectores 17 (N$40) y 16 (N$49) sin asignar nombre. ¿Deliberado?.
8.- Puedes suministrarme elpatillaje de tu TFT (4=LCD_RS, 5=LCD_WR, ....). Te lo agradecería ya que el que yo tengo no se porque me da que es "rarito".
9.- En conector ISCP, existen 2 LABEL identificados como RB6- y RB7-, ¿tienen algún significado?.

Buff, menudo pesadez de tio que soy. Lo siento.

Un fuerte abrazo,

Jc



Desconectado Suky

  • Moderador Local
  • DsPIC33
  • *****
  • Mensajes: 6743
    • Micros-Designs
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#51 en: 09 de Diciembre de 2011, 22:17:22 »
1. Como dice, entre 15pF y 27pF. Podes revisar el datasheet, pero generalmente se coloca 22pF.
2. En dispositivos con USB allí esta VBUS, revisar datasheets.
3. Es fácil realizarlo, tienes el datasheet del TPS2041B y aquí RedPic explica como se puede hacer.
4. Es el pin para detectar cuando se introduce una SD Card  :tongue:
5. Revisar datasheet, allí indica de bajo ESR.
6. Revisar datasheet de PIC24/32 con USB  ;-)
7. VDCAP y ENVREG  ;-)
8. Por lo que he visto existe un estandar, por aquí lo puedes ver.
9. Es para colocar resistencias entre DATA y CLOCK y el uso del pin. Más detalles por aquí

Realizar ese esquema en una placa simple faz va a ser un reto bastante importante, ánimos  ;-)


Saludos!
No contesto mensajes privados, las consultas en el foro

Desconectado xp8100

  • PIC12
  • **
  • Mensajes: 71
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#52 en: 09 de Diciembre de 2011, 22:59:13 »
Rápido y conciso, si señor.

Gracias Suky!.

Jc

Desconectado Diego Gonzalez

  • PIC18
  • ****
  • Mensajes: 319
    • Visita mi web sobre electronica,fisica,mecanica y demas temas....
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#53 en: 15 de Diciembre de 2011, 18:59:11 »
Hola Suky

Yo tambien puede que me meta en este interesante proyecto. Muchas gracias por compartirlo. Es estupendo. Tambien vi unos videos en youtube realmente buenos.
Gracias por todo.

Tengo una pregunta. aunque mas bien busco opiniones personales respecto a futuros proyectos. En general, ¿como encarais el tema de las adaptaciones de tensiones TTl entre micros y sensores por ejemplo, o ciertos perifericos como lcds, memorias, etc...? ¿Es preocupante en cuanto a la pesadez de realizar conversores de niveles? ¿Procurais tener todo al mismo nivel o directamente adaptais lo que teneis (tipicos 5v)?

Un saludo!
Visita mi web sobre electronica,fisica,mecanica y demas temas....

http://sites.google.com/site/skygaps/Home

Desconectado Suky

  • Moderador Local
  • DsPIC33
  • *****
  • Mensajes: 6743
    • Micros-Designs
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#54 en: 15 de Diciembre de 2011, 20:31:51 »
Cuando me toco implementar dispositivos que si o si necesitaban recibir señales >4.5 V (GLCD) implementé adaptadores de nivel (Hay C.I. muy variados para este propósito), pero generalmente los dispositivos permiten trabajarlo a 3.3 V o en todo caso toman esos 3.3 V como un 1 lógico.


Saludos!
No contesto mensajes privados, las consultas en el foro

Desconectado MerLiNz

  • Colaborador
  • PIC24H
  • *****
  • Mensajes: 2463
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#55 en: 15 de Diciembre de 2011, 22:47:09 »
Cuando me toco implementar dispositivos que si o si necesitaban recibir señales >4.5 V (GLCD) implementé adaptadores de nivel (Hay C.I. muy variados para este propósito), pero generalmente los dispositivos permiten trabajarlo a 3.3 V o en todo caso toman esos 3.3 V como un 1 lógico.


Saludos!

No te vino mejor usar los pines por colector abierto con una pull-up?

Tu que seguro que lo habras probado, en la mayoria de integrados pone el voltaje minimo para HIGH 0.7VDD osea si esta a 5V serian 3,5V lo toma como 1 logico? Lo digo porque en la mayoria de datasheet viene asi.
« Última modificación: 15 de Diciembre de 2011, 22:49:40 por MerLiNz »

Desconectado Suky

  • Moderador Local
  • DsPIC33
  • *****
  • Mensajes: 6743
    • Micros-Designs
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#56 en: 15 de Diciembre de 2011, 23:55:22 »
Cuando me toco implementar dispositivos que si o si necesitaban recibir señales >4.5 V (GLCD) implementé adaptadores de nivel (Hay C.I. muy variados para este propósito), pero generalmente los dispositivos permiten trabajarlo a 3.3 V o en todo caso toman esos 3.3 V como un 1 lógico.


Saludos!

No te vino mejor usar los pines por colector abierto con una pull-up?

Hable de forma general, no específicamente de un PIC32, y en los casos que lo utilice no disponía de esa posibilidad.

Citar
Tu que seguro que lo habras probado, en la mayoria de integrados pone el voltaje minimo para HIGH 0.7VDD osea si esta a 5V serian 3,5V lo toma como 1 logico? Lo digo porque en la mayoria de datasheet viene asi.

Si, es cierto. Pero los 3.3 V los toman como 1 lógico, igualmente siempre me aseguro probando en un protoboard  ;-)
No contesto mensajes privados, las consultas en el foro

Desconectado Diego Gonzalez

  • PIC18
  • ****
  • Mensajes: 319
    • Visita mi web sobre electronica,fisica,mecanica y demas temas....
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#57 en: 17 de Diciembre de 2011, 05:57:07 »
Gracias por la respuesta Suky.

Me estoy leyendo el libro. Ademas a la espera de unas muestras que pueden ser programadas por icd2 clone y pickit2 clone :P y luego a ver si monto una placa modular

keep it going!! ;-)
Visita mi web sobre electronica,fisica,mecanica y demas temas....

http://sites.google.com/site/skygaps/Home

Desconectado Diego Gonzalez

  • PIC18
  • ****
  • Mensajes: 319
    • Visita mi web sobre electronica,fisica,mecanica y demas temas....
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#58 en: 17 de Diciembre de 2011, 19:43:21 »
Ultima pregunta, Suky.
¿Puedes darme la referencia de tu memoria SPI (Fabricante con Samples si es posible  :))?
Por cierto, la versión más avanzada de C32 que he conseguido es la 1.04, entiendo que servirá para empezar.
Jc

 Pero no usas la 2.02 disponible em microchip?

yo estoy teniendi problemas ilogicos... :( abrire un tema de consulta si no avanzo nada :(
Visita mi web sobre electronica,fisica,mecanica y demas temas....

http://sites.google.com/site/skygaps/Home

Desconectado Diego Gonzalez

  • PIC18
  • ****
  • Mensajes: 319
    • Visita mi web sobre electronica,fisica,mecanica y demas temas....
Re: Ejemplos en MPLAB C32. Placa de desarrollo SkP32 xD
« Respuesta #59 en: 17 de Diciembre de 2011, 21:17:30 »
Hola.

Lo confirmo que ya me funciona la version nueva. Pense que era algun posible problema mio, y efectivamente, tras tanta actualizacion del mplab no me funcionaba bien. He instalado el 8.83 con version pic32 2.02 y ya estoy realizando los primeros programas y simulandolos perfectamente. Os dejo las librerias (que ya conoceran los veteranos) pero yo no las conocia

http://www.microchip.com/stellent/idcplg?IdcService=SS_GET_PAGE&nodeId=2680&dDocName=en547784

Visita mi web sobre electronica,fisica,mecanica y demas temas....

http://sites.google.com/site/skygaps/Home


 

anything